Financing Options and Incentives for Commercial Solar Adoption
Financing a commercial solar system can feel daunting. However, various options and incentives exist to make it easier. Many businesses take advantage of federal tax credits. These credits can significantly lower initial costs. Some states also offer rebates and grants that can ease financial pressure. Understanding your local regulations can help maximize these benefits.
Leasing solar equipment is another option. This can reduce upfront costs and provide predictable monthly expenses. Power purchase agreements allow businesses to pay for the power generated rather than the system itself. Some companies find these arrangements less risky. Additionally, many financial institutions are now offering specific loans for renewable energy projects, making funding more accessible.
It’s essential to evaluate the long-term benefits. Solar systems drive down energy costs and reduce dependence on traditional power sources. However, the initial investment and maintenance can be challenging. Encouragingly, the growing interest in sustainability means more resources and support are becoming available. Conducting thorough research is crucial to navigating your choices.
Why Choose a Commercial Solar System for Your Business? - Financing Options and Incentives for Commercial Solar Adoption
| Financing Option | Description | Potential Savings (%) | Federal Incentives | State Incentives |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Cash Purchase | Pay upfront for the solar system, owning it outright. | 20-30% | 30% Federal Tax Credit | Varies by state |
| Solar Loan | Financing option with payments over time, retaining ownership. | 15-25% | 30% Federal Tax Credit | Varies by state |
|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) | No upfront cost; pay for the power generated by the solar system. | 10-15% | None | Varies by state |
| Lease | Pay a monthly fee to use the solar system; ownership remains with the provider. | 5-10% | None | Varies by state |
Long-Term Maintenance and Efficiency of Solar Systems in Business
Investing in a commercial solar system can significantly enhance both efficiency and long-term maintenance for businesses. Solar systems require regular upkeep, which provides an opportunity for companies to establish a reliable maintenance schedule. Cleaning the panels and checking connections can help maintain optimal performance. Many businesses overlook these tasks, which can lead to decreased efficiency over time.
Regular inspection is crucial. Keeping systems clean can lead to a 25% increase in energy production. Setting up a routine every six months can be beneficial. This often involves hiring professionals, but it is worth the investment. A small cost today can save a significant amount on energy bills in the future.
Business leaders may focus on initial installation costs and forget long-term savings. However, understanding solar system longevity is essential. Most panels have warranties lasting 20-25 years. Monitoring energy output regularly will help identify any potential issues quickly. Ignoring these details may reduce the overall return on investment and undermine the effectiveness of the solar installation.
